πŸ₯„ Ingredients (Makes 2 servings):

  • 1 cup low-fat or fat-free cottage cheese (0–2 Points depending on WW plan)
  • 2 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der (0 Points)
  • 1.5–2 tbsp erythritol or monk fruit sweetener (0 Points)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ract (0 Points)
  • Pinch of salt (0 Points)
  • Optional toppings(add points if used):
    • 1 tsp sugar-free chocolate chips (1 Point)
    • Crushed almonds or walnuts (add per WW calculator)

πŸ’‘ WW Points:
~1–2 Points per serving (depending on cottage cheese and toppings)


πŸ‘©β€πŸ³ Instructions:

  1. Blend: In a blender or food processor, combine cottage cheese, cocoa powder, sweetener, vanilla, and salt. Blend until completely smooth and mousse-like.
  2. Taste: Adjust sweetness or cocoa if needed.
  3. Chill: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to thicken.
  4. Serve: Top with optional chocolate chips or nuts, or enjoy as-is!
